Subject: [PATCH 12/39] ARM: u300: set up board power from device tree
Date: Fri, 31 May 2013 12:37:12 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<6621177.ZgrPQ48FXE@wuerfel>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1369991954-17406-13-git-send-email-linus.walleij@stericsson.com>

On Friday 31 May 2013 11:18:47 Linus Walleij wrote:
> From: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org>
> 
> This adds support for setting up the board power from the
> device tree on the U300. We use a board-specific node in the
> device tree for the S365 board and bind a regulator for the
> board power to this node.
> 
> Cc: Mark Brown <broonie@kernel.org>
> Signed-off-by: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org>

This is fairly unusual, I think I've never seen a platform driver
registered for a board.  Is that the intended method for hogging
a regulator?
